Creamy Garlic Butter Shrimp Alfredo Recipe
Introduction
Creamy Garlic Butter Shrimp Alfredo is a comforting and indulgent pasta dish that’s perfect for weeknights or special occasions. With tender shrimp sautéed in garlic butter and tossed in a rich Alfredo sauce, this meal feels fancy without the fuss. Ready in under 30 minutes, it’s a guaranteed crowd-pleaser.

Ingredients
- 1 lb shrimp – peeled, deveined, tails off (medium or large)
- 3 tbsp butter
- 4 cloves garlic, minced
- Salt & pepper, to taste
- Pinch of red pepper flakes (optional)
- 2 tbsp butter (for sauce)
- 1½ cups heavy cream
- 1 cup grated Parmesan cheese
- 8 oz fettuccine or linguine pasta
- Chopped parsley (optional, for garnish)
Instructions
- Step 1: Bring a large pot of salted water to a boil. Cook the pasta until al dente according to package instructions. Drain, reserving about ½ cup of pasta water, and set aside.
- Step 2: In a large skillet over medium heat, melt 3 tablespoons of butter. Add the minced garlic and cook for about 30 seconds until fragrant.
- Step 3: Add the shrimp to the skillet. Season with salt, pepper, and red pepper flakes if using. Cook shrimp about 2–3 minutes per side until pink and opaque. Remove shrimp from skillet and set aside.
- Step 4: In the same skillet, melt 2 tablespoons of butter. Pour in the heavy cream and stir. Let it simmer gently for 3–4 minutes, avoiding a boil.
- Step 5: Slowly whisk in the grated Parmesan cheese until the sauce is smooth and creamy. Taste and season with salt and pepper as needed. If the sauce is too thick, add a splash of reserved pasta water to loosen it.
- Step 6: Add the drained pasta to the sauce and toss well to coat. Gently stir the shrimp back into the pan and warm through for about a minute.
- Step 7: Serve immediately, garnished with chopped parsley and freshly ground black pepper if desired.
Tips & Variations
- Don’t overcook the shrimp to avoid a rubbery texture; they cook very quickly.
- Simmer the cream gently—boiling can cause the sauce to separate.
- Use freshly grated Parmesan for a smoother sauce; pre-shredded often contains fillers that prevent proper melting.
- The reserved pasta water is great for adjusting sauce consistency and helping it cling to the noodles.
- For a dairy-free version, substitute vegan butter, use oat or cashew cream, and replace Parmesan with nutritional yeast or vegan Parmesan.
- Try adding sun-dried tomatoes, spinach, or roasted red peppers for extra flavor.
- Gluten-free pasta works perfectly as a substitute if needed.
Storage
Store leftovers in an airtight container in the refrigerator for up to 2 days. Alfredo sauce tends to separate when reheated, so warm gently on the stove with a splash of milk or water to restore creaminess. Shrimp is best eaten fresh, as it can become rubbery upon reheating.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use frozen shrimp?
Yes, just thaw the shrimp first by running them under cold water for a few minutes before cooking.
Is this dish very rich?
Yes, it is rich and indulgent—that’s part of its charm! It makes for a satisfying, comforting meal.
Can I make this dish ahead of time?
You can prepare it in advance, but keep in mind that Alfredo sauce doesn’t reheat well in the microwave. Reheat gently on the stove with a splash of milk or water for best results.
Can I use milk instead of heavy cream?
You can use milk, but the sauce will be thinner and less creamy, more like a garlic butter sauce than a traditional Alfredo. Adding a bit of cream cheese can help thicken it.
What wine pairs well with this dish?
A crisp white wine such as Pinot Grigio or Sauvignon Blanc balances the richness of the sauce beautifully, making it an excellent pairing.
PrintCreamy Garlic Butter Shrimp Alfredo Recipe
Creamy Garlic Butter Shrimp Alfredo is an indulgent, flavorful pasta dish combining succulent shrimp sautéed in garlic butter with a rich, creamy homemade Alfredo sauce. Tossed with perfectly cooked fettuccine or linguine, this meal is the ultimate comfort food that’s simple enough for weeknights but impressive enough for guests. With fresh Parmesan and optional parsley garnish, it’s a decadent seafood twist on a classic Italian favorite.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 4 servings 1x
- Category: Main Dish
- Method: Stovetop
- Cuisine: Italian
Ingredients
Shrimp
- 1 lb shrimp – peeled, deveined, tails off (medium or large)
- 3 tbsp butter
- 4 cloves garlic, minced
- Salt & pepper, to taste
- Optional: pinch of red pepper flakes
Alfredo Sauce
- 2 tbsp butter
- 1½ cups heavy cream
- 1 cup grated Parmesan cheese
- Salt & pepper, to taste
Pasta & Garnish
- 8 oz fettuccine or linguine pasta
- Chopped parsley for garnish (optional)
Instructions
- Boil the Pasta: Bring a large pot of salted water to a boil. Add the pasta and cook until al dente according to package instructions. Reserve about ½ cup of pasta water, then drain the pasta.
- Sauté the Shrimp: In a large skillet over medium heat, melt 3 tablespoons of butter. Add the minced garlic and sauté for about 30 seconds until fragrant. Add the shrimp and season with salt, pepper, and red pepper flakes if using. Cook shrimp 2–3 minutes per side until pink and opaque. Remove shrimp from skillet and set aside to avoid overcooking.
- Prepare Alfredo Sauce: In the same skillet, melt 2 tablespoons of butter. Pour in the heavy cream and gently simmer for 3-4 minutes. Avoid boiling to prevent curdling.
- Add the Cheese: Gradually whisk in the grated Parmesan until the sauce is smooth and creamy. Season with salt and pepper to taste. If the sauce is too thick, add a splash of the reserved pasta water to loosen it.
- Combine Pasta and Shrimp: Add the drained pasta to the Alfredo sauce and toss to coat well. Return the shrimp to the skillet, gently mixing everything together. Let it warm through for about a minute.
- Serve: Plate the pasta and shrimp, garnishing with chopped parsley if desired. Optionally, finish with freshly cracked black pepper for extra flair. Enjoy immediately for best results.
Notes
- Do not overcook shrimp to avoid rubbery texture; cook just until pink and opaque.
- Simmer cream gently to prevent the sauce from splitting or curdling.
- Use freshly grated Parmesan cheese for a smoother, creamier sauce rather than pre-shredded varieties.
- Reserve some pasta water to help loosen and bind the sauce.
- Best served fresh as Alfredo sauce does not reheat well in the microwave; if reheating, do so gently on the stove with a splash of milk or water.
- Substitute shrimp with mushrooms, chicken strips, or broccoli for variations.
- Use gluten-free pasta if needed to make the dish gluten-free friendly.
- For dairy-free versions, use vegan butter, plant-based cream alternatives, and nutritional yeast or vegan Parmesan.
Keywords: Shrimp Alfredo, Garlic Butter Shrimp, Creamy Pasta, Italian Dinner, Fettuccine Alfredo, Easy Shrimp Recipe

